How CFO Recruiting Firms Evaluate Financial Leadership Skills
Chief Monetary Officer roles sit at the center of modern enterprise strategy, which is why corporations often turn to specialised CFO recruiting firms to seek out the proper financial leader. These firms do far more than scan résumés for accounting credentials. Their evaluation process focuses closely on financial leadership skills that influence long term development, stability, and investor confidence.
CFO recruiting firms start by defining what financial leadership means for a specific organization. A startup getting ready for fast expansion needs a different type of CFO than a mature company centered on cost control and shareholder returns. Recruiters work closely with boards and CEOs to understand strategic goals, risk tolerance, funding plans, and operational complexity. This context shapes how they assess every candidate’s leadership profile.
One of the first areas recruiters examine is strategic financial thinking. Strong CFO candidates demonstrate the ability to translate numbers into business direction. Throughout interviews and case discussions, recruiting firms look for examples of how a candidate has supported mergers, guided pricing strategies, improved capital allocation, or helped enter new markets. They want proof that the executive can move past reporting and actively shape firm strategy.
Another key factor is choice making under pressure. Financial leaders usually face high stakes situations corresponding to liquidity crises, regulatory investigations, or sudden revenue declines. CFO recruiting firms ask behavioral questions that explore how candidates handled financial uncertainty within the past. They listen for structured thinking, calm communication, and the ability to balance short term survival with long term value creation.
Communication skills play a central role in evaluating monetary leadership. A CFO must speak the language of investors, board members, department heads, and generally the public. Recruiters assess how clearly candidates clarify complicated monetary data to non monetary audiences. They could ask candidates to walk through a past board presentation or describe how they satisfied operational leaders to adchoose cost controls or new reporting systems.
Team leadership and talent development are additionally critical. Modern finance departments handle data analytics, compliance, forecasting, and technology integration. CFO recruiting firms look for leaders who've constructed strong finance teams, mentored future leaders, and created cultures of accountability. They often ask about how a candidate restructured a department, implemented new monetary systems, or improved cross functional collaboration.
Technical experience still matters, however it is evaluated through a leadership lens. Recruiters review expertise with financial planning and evaluation, treasury management, audit oversight, and regulatory compliance. Nevertheless, they focus less on textbook knowledge and more on how successfully the candidate used technical tools to drive enterprise results. Experience with digital transformation, automation, and data pushed forecasting can significantly strengthen a candidate’s profile.
Ethics and integrity are non negotiable qualities for monetary executives. CFO recruiting firms conduct in depth reference checks to understand a candidate’s reputation for transparency and governance. They need evidence that the leader has upheld sturdy inner controls, handled sensitive information responsibly, and maintained trust with auditors and regulators. Cultural fit also plays into this assessment, since values alignment reduces the risk of leadership conflict.
Finally, adaptability is increasingly essential in evaluating monetary leadership skills. Economic volatility, changing regulations, and fast technological shifts demand flexible thinking. Recruiters discover how candidates responded to major trade changes, resembling adopting new accounting standards or leading finance teams through digital upgrades. Executives who show curiosity, continuous learning, and openness to innovation typically stand out.
By combining strategic insight, behavioral analysis, and deep trade knowledge, CFO recruiting firms build a complete picture of every candidate. Their process ensures that companies hire monetary leaders who can guide performance, manage risk, and inspire confidence across the organization.
